Default Navigation question

I sat in a 2008 350z with Navigation and behind the drivers seat there was a place to load DVD's Is this only on the 08's? Or can you watch DVD's on any year as long as they have the Nav? Can you watch them while you're driving?

no, that is the nav disc, how they update the info. wont play anything. At least not from the factory. All z's with nav have same thing.

You can if you mod the factory nav...

First off you need a switch box to be able to switch between nav disc to aux input. check out http://www.tvandnav2go.com/ to purchase their unit.

you need this module to tap into the factory nav screen, then from there you can connect anything you want via RCA wires....DVD player, Xbox...etc.

Originally Posted by coachk22
will the factory nav screen actually work as a monitor?? I was under the impression that it would not. I may be wrong???
YES! it will work as a basic LCD screen...see my thread posted above on post 6!!..

i hooked up an Xbox...you can hook up a dvd player instead, I chose Xbox because it does more...

i have seen small dvd players installed in the small rear glove box cubby behind the passenger seat next to the rear speaker......, so passenger side had the movie playing DVD player and behind the driver side was the OEM factory DVD nav disc slot player..
